Carpet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small spill on a small area of carpet Yes No It’s manageable with quick action and basic tools.
Water under the carpet from a leak No Yes It’s hidden and can lead to mold if not handled right.
Standing water over 2 inches deep No Yes It’s a big job that needs professional equipment and expertise.
Water damage after a flood or major storm No Yes It’s a large-scale issue that needs specialized tools and experience.
Water damage with a musty smell or visible mold No Yes It’s a health risk and needs professional cleaning and drying.
Water damage in a high-traffic area No Yes It’s a safety issue and needs quick, thorough restoration.

Carpet Water Damage Restoration Cost In Grapevine, TX

Carpet Water Damage Restoration costs vary based on the size of the area, the type of water, and how long it’s been there. You can expect to pay anywhere from $500 to $2,500 for most jobs. It’s not just about the water, it’s about the damage it causes. The more time it sits, the more it costs. That’s why acting fast is so important. And that’s why we’re here to help. It’s not just about the price, it’s about the results. And that’s what makes all the difference.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ial water removal $200 – $600 Amount of water, location, and time since the incident.
Carpet extraction and drying $500 – $1,500 Size of the area, type of carpet, and moisture levels.
Deep cleaning and sanitization $150 – $400 Amount of dirt, mold, or mildew present.
Restoration and replacement $300 – $1,000 Extent of damage and need for carpet replacement.
Moisture testing and monitoring $100 – $300 Duration of the drying process and equipment used.
Odor removal and decontamination $200 – $600 Severity of the smell and type of contaminants.
